Looking for warm weather? Then head to Somerset in July, when the average temperature is 75.2 °F, and the highest can go up to 86 °F. The coldest month, on the other hand, is January, when it can get as cold as 24.8 °F, with an average temperature of 33.8 °F. You’re likely to see more rain in May, when precipitation is around 4.9″. In contrast, October is usually the driest month of the year in Somerset, with an average rainfall of 2.9″.

How to Get to Somerset

Plane

Although Somerset doesn’t have its own airport, you can fly to Lexington Blue Grass (LEX), which is located 105 km from Somerset. Louisville Airport is the most popular, with regular flights from American Airlines, Delta, WestJet and other airlines departing from the United States. The shortest domestic flight to Somerset departs from Fort Lauderdale and takes around 2h 20m.

Car

Another option to get to Somerset is to pick up a car rental from Nashville, which is about 220 km from Somerset. You’ll find branches of Hertz and Budget, among others, in Nashville.

Bus

Several bus lines operate bus routes to Somerset, including FlixBus, Greyhound and Tornado Bus. From New York, the bus ride to Somerset takes 2229 km and will cost you around $129. From West Pensacola, the ticket costs about $320 for a journey of 3339 km.

Renting a car in Somerset

Renting a car in Somerset costs $85 per day, on average, or $170 if you want to rent if for 2 days.

You’re likely to save money by renting your car at the airport: locations in the city are, on average, 12% more expensive than at Lexington Blue Grass.

Expect to pay $3.90 per gallon in Somerset (average price from the past 30 days). Depending on the size of your rental car, filling up the tank will cost between $46.79 and $62.38. The most frequently booked car type in Somerset is Economy (Mitsubishi Mirage or similar). If you’re looking to save money, though, keep in mind that Compact rental cars (Toyota Corolla or similar) are, on average, 21% cheaper than other rental car types in the city.
